When I open a new tab page, the most used sites flash up for a microsecond then disappear, leaving the page looking like it's always looked. I looked for the pin icon and couldn't find one, so I tried dragging a bookmark onto it and I was just taken to the bookmarked page. I haven't cleared the cache and it wasn't full either. Any ideas?

Does the page open if you type about:newtab in the location bar?

Start Firefox in Diagnose Firefox issues using Troubleshoot Mode to check if one of the extensions or if hardware acceleration is causing the problem (switch to the DEFAULT theme: Firefox/Tools > Add-ons > Appearance/Themes).

Thanks, it was an extension for the nectar search toolbar that I never used anyway. Only took 5 mins to sort it, many thanks
